    Abstract: A method for manufacturing metal strip comprises abutting at least two metal strips to form a abutment interface between each other, then welding the metal strips along the abutment interface by a laser light to form a weld pass with a welding penetration depth between the metal strips, and a reflected light is reflected from the weld pass, and finally receiving the reflected light by a spectrometer which can determine the welding penetration depth according to the reflected light spectrum. A welding parameter can be selectively adjusted according to the welding penetration depth to correct the welding penetration depth in real time, and the follow-up weld pass can conform to the specification for decreasing weld defective ratio.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to a manufacturing method for advanced high-strength steel (AHSS) wheel, comprising the following steps. Take an AHSS with at least 590 MPa of tensile strength for rolling to circular ring of a rim. Apply low heat input welding, such as the cold metal transfer (CMT) welding or the gas tungsten arc welding/tungsten inert gas arc welding (GTAW/TIG), at the junction of the rim to form a hollow cylindrical rim. Then perform hole expanding and spinning/roll forming operations to the rim. Take another AHSS with at least 980 MPa of tensile strength for pressing and forming a disk. Apply low heat input welding, such as cold metal transfer (CMT) welding, to the rim and the disk to produce a wheel. According to the present invention, the welding quality of products can be improved significantly; the fatigue lifetime of wheels can be enhanced; and wheels are lightweight.

    Abstract: An automatic welding method includes a preliminary step and a joining step. The preliminary step is configured to place a metal object having a multi-dimensional curved weld zone on a platform, and to clamp a welding torch with a welding torch clamping device. The joining step is configured to generate a relative movement between a tip of the welding torch and the multi-dimensional curved weld zone of the metal object, and to electrify the welding torch to weld the metal object by way of short circuiting arc transfer. An angle difference between a reference position and an instant position of the welding torch is 0 to 135 degrees when the welding torch welds the metal object, so as to keep the slag from spraying, wherein the welding torch is at the reference position when the tip thereof is pointed straight down towards the ground.

    Abstract: The present invention provides a miniature high-power laser diode device, which includes a base, a laser chip, an optical fiber guider, and an optical fiber. The base has a groove and a disposing area, and the groove connects to the disposing area. The laser chip is disposed on the disposing area, and the optical fiber guider is disposed at the groove. The optical fiber is disposed in and through the optical fiber guider. The optical fiber has a first end connected to the laser chip. As a result of the cooperation between the optical fiber guider and the groove, the orientation of the optical fiber is simple and precise. The conventional thermal deformation and residual welding stress can be reduced, and the soldering flux applied in a conventional soldering and packaging process of the optical fiber can be omitted, so that the coupling efficiency, the yield, the stability of high power laser output, and the lifetime of the laser diode device of the present invention can be improved.
